Project: 
US Robotics External Modem Setup for 
Communication with Omron C-Series PLC

Set your dip switches to the following for a US Robotics Modem .V90
1,2,3,4,8 =>On
5,6,7=>OFF

1. Modem ignores DTR(override)
2. Numeric Result codes
3. Enable Result code display
4. Command Mode Local Echo Suppression (Suppress echo)
5. Modem answers on First Ring
6. Carrier Detect always ON
7. Load Y0-Y4 on Power up from NVRAM
8. AT Command Set (smart mode)

NVRAM Settings (When using HyperTerminal “AT” must precede each setting i.e. AT&A1)
&A1  ARQ result code enabled
&B1  Fixed Serial Port rate
&H1  Hardware Flow Control  Clear to Send (CTS)
&I0   Software flow control disabled
&K0  Data Compression Disabled
&M4  Normal/ARQ
&N6   Connection set to 9600 baud
&P0   U.S./Canada ratio
&R1   Modem ignores RTS
&S0   DSR override
&T5    Prohibit Remote digital loopback

Note: Don’t forget to save the changes to NVRAM. This command is AT&W0. This must be done because when DIP switch 7 is OFF the modem loads this custom set up from NVRAM.

Cable Pin Out
25Pin Male D-sub     9Pin Male D-sub
2---------------------------------2
3---------------------------------3
4---------------------------------5
5---------------------------------4
7---------------------------------9-7
6-20

Note:  Check the PLC port setup. If using a CS1 and the port is set for NT Link, the modem will not answer. The modem will attempt to Auto Connect but will fail.
